Output 44ea44f756c6c5c3976d62ae6df2fc236149cd477881a67281b2ba3b6ef7b59d:0

value
23646400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af564265a77841c3ae53844b01607b3f1658d758 OP_EQUAL
address
MPtFpQWbkd4B3JKBkxLNZmyygLCHvSpWdL
transaction
44ea44f756c6c5c3976d62ae6df2fc236149cd477881a67281b2ba3b6ef7b59d
spent
true